image 1
image 2
image 3
Magento
Shopware
Circles image
Step-by-Step Migration Guide

Magento to Shopware

Migrating your store from Magento to Shopware might seem daunting, but with proper planning and the right tools, it's a smooth process. Follow this step-by-step guide to ensure a successful transition.

Schedule a call
Background image
Guide Overview

Step-by-Step Migration Guide: Magento to Shopware migration guide

Step 1: Preparation for Migration

Objective: The preparation phase is crucial for a successful migration. We ensure that your data is ready and that we have a clear understanding of what needs to be migrated. This step helps in minimizing risks and ensuring data integrity during the migration process.

Before we begin the migration, we will take the following actions:

  1. Assess the Current System: Review your existing Magento store to identify the data that needs to be migrated, including products, customers, orders, and any custom configurations.
  2. Backup Data: Always create a full backup of your Magento store. This includes:
    • Database files
    • Media files (images, documents)
    • Configuration files

    Use tools like phpMyAdmin for database backups and FTP clients for file backups.

  3. Document Current Settings: Note down crucial settings such as payment methods, shipping configurations, and any custom code that may affect the migration.
  4. Determine Migration Requirements: Decide on the data types you wish to migrate. This may include:
    • Products and product attributes
    • Customer data
    • Order history
    • Categories and SEO settings
  5. Check Compatibility: Ensure that your Magento version is compatible with the migration tools and the Shopware version you plan to use.

By the end of this step, we will have a solid foundation for proceeding with the migration.

Step 2: Setting Up Shopware Environment

Objective: The primary goal of this step is to establish a well-configured Shopware installation that will serve as the new home for your migrated data.

Follow these detailed steps to set up your Shopware environment:

  1. Choose the Hosting Option: Decide between self-hosted or partner-hosted solutions. Ensure your hosting provider supports Shopware’s system requirements.
  2. Install Shopware: Download the latest version of Shopware from the official website and install it on your server. Follow these sub-steps:
    • Upload the Shopware files to your server.
    • Create a new database for Shopware using your hosting control panel.
    • Run the Shopware installer via your web browser and follow the on-screen instructions.
  3. Configure Basic Settings: After installation, log in to the Shopware admin panel and configure essential settings:
    • Set up your shop details (name, logo, etc.)
    • Configure payment and shipping methods that will be used post-migration.
    • Install relevant plugins that may be needed for the migration.
  4. Set Up Migration Assistant: Install the Migration Assistant plugin from the Shopware store. This tool will facilitate the migration from Magento to Shopware. Ensure it’s correctly configured to connect to your Magento database.

Concluding this step, your Shopware environment will be ready to receive data from Magento.

Step 3: Establishing Database Connection

Objective: A successful connection between Shopware and Magento is essential for data transfer. This step ensures that the Migration Assistant can access Magento data.

To set up the database connection, proceed with the following:

  1. Access Shopware Admin Panel: Log in to your Shopware admin interface.
  2. Navigate to Migration Assistant: Go to Settings > Extensions > Migration Assistant.
  3. Create a New Connection: Click on Add Connection and enter the following details:
    • Connection Name: Provide a unique name for the connection.
    • Profile: Select the Magento profile corresponding to your Magento version (e.g., Magento 1.9).
    • Database Host: Input the database host URL (e.g., localhost if hosted on the same server).
    • Database User: Enter the database username with admin rights.
    • Password: Provide the database user's password.
    • Database Name: Input the name of the Magento database.
  4. Test the Connection: Click the Test Connection button to ensure all details are correct. A successful connection message should appear.
  5. Save the Connection: If the connection test is successful, save the connection settings.

By completing this step, you will have established a secure link for data migration.

Step 4: Selecting Data for Migration

Objective: Data selection is vital to ensure that only the necessary information is migrated, which can prevent clutter and potential data issues in the new system.

To select data for migration, follow these steps:

  1. Go to Migration Assistant: In the Shopware admin panel, navigate back to the Migration Assistant.
  2. Choose Your Connection: Select the connection you set up in the previous step to connect to your Magento database.
  3. Data Selection: You will see a list of data types that can be migrated. This typically includes:
    • Products
    • Customers
    • Orders
    • Categories
    • CMS pages
    • SEO settings
  4. Select Data Types: Check the boxes next to the data types you wish to migrate. It’s generally advisable to migrate:
    • All products and their attributes
    • Customer data, including addresses
    • Order history to maintain customer information
  5. Review Selected Data: After selection, review the list to ensure that unnecessary data is not included.

This step will ensure that only relevant data is transferred from Magento to Shopware, which is crucial for a clean migration.

Step 5: Initiating the Migration Process

Objective: The migration step is where all the preparation pays off. We will initiate the data transfer, making sure to monitor the process for any issues.

Follow these steps to start the migration:

  1. Return to Migration Assistant: Log back into the Shopware admin panel and navigate to the Migration Assistant.
  2. Select Your Connection: Choose the connection established earlier with your Magento database.
  3. Start Migration: Click on the Start Migration button. You will enter a migration overview screen where you can see:
    • A summary of selected data
    • Estimated time for migration
    • Any warnings or notes regarding the process
  4. Monitor the Migration: As the migration progresses, keep an eye on the status updates. If any errors occur, they will be displayed here. Common error messages might include connection issues or data integrity warnings.
  5. Completion Notification: Once the migration is complete, you will receive a notification detailing the success and the amount of data transferred.

With this step completed, your data should now be successfully migrated to Shopware.

Step 6: Post-Migration Data Verification

Objective: Verification is key to ensuring that the migration was successful and that all data is intact and functional in Shopware.

Follow these steps to verify your migrated data:

  1. Log into Shopware: Access your new Shopware admin panel.
  2. Check Data Integrity: Perform checks to ensure data has been correctly transferred:
    • Verify product details (names, prices, descriptions)
    • Ensure customer details are accurate and accessible
    • Review orders to confirm historical accuracy
  3. Test Functionality: Check that all functionalities are working as expected:
    • Test payment gateways
    • Ensure shipping methods are correctly configured
    • Review category structures and SEO settings
  4. Resolve Any Issues: If discrepancies are found, address them immediately. This may involve re-migrating specific data or manually correcting errors.

By the conclusion of this step, you should have a fully functional Shopware environment with accurately migrated data.

Step 7: Launching Your Shopware Store

Objective: Launching your Shopware store requires careful planning to ensure that your customers experience minimal disruption during the transition.

To prepare for launch, follow these steps:

  1. Final Review: Conduct a thorough review of your store setup, including:
    • Website design and layout
    • Product visibility
    • Payment and shipping configurations
  2. Test User Experience: Perform a test run of the shopping experience:
    • Simulate the checkout process
    • Test various payment methods
    • Check for any broken links or missing images
  3. Announce the Launch: Communicate with your customers about the migration. Use email campaigns or social media to inform them about the new features and enhancements available on your Shopware store.
  4. Go Live: Once everything is verified and tested, you can officially launch your Shopware store. Transition your DNS settings if necessary, to point to your new Shopware platform.

Upon completion of this step, your Shopware store will be live and ready for business!

Power Your Step - Get in Touch

Ready to elevate your ecommerce experience?

We at PowerCommerce are committed to making your migration from Magento to Shopware seamless and effective. Our team of experts is here to support you every step of the way, ensuring that your transition is smooth and your new Shopware environment is optimized for success.

To get started, follow these simple steps:

  1. Visit our contact page: Contact Us
  2. Call us directly at 800-099-9090
  3. Email us at info@powercommerce.com

Your satisfaction is our priority, and we look forward to helping you power your ecommerce journey!

Trusted by 1000+ innovative companies worldwide

Schedule Your Migration Today

For businesses prioritizing simplicity, scalability, and robust support, Shopify is the clear winner.

Looking to migrate without hassle? Power Commerce can handle the entire process, ensuring smooth data transfer, store setup, and post-launch success.


Marka Marulića 2, Sarajevo, 71000 BiH

00387 60 345 5801

info@powercommerce.com

Tell Us about yourself and we’ll get back to you shortly.

By submitting this form, you agree to Power Commerce's Terms of Service and Privacy Policy.